Ingredients

Scale
  • 16 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 1 sleeve graham crackers or digestive biscuits, crushed
  • 3 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 cup Golden Oreos or vanilla sandwich cookies, crushed
  • 1 cup freeze-dried strawberries or strawberry-flavored Jell-O powder

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, blend the softened cream cheese, heavy whipping c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  2. Optionally swirl in strawberry jam or puree for added color.
  3. Combine crushed graham crackers with melted butter and press into a baking sheet to form the crust.
  4. Spread the cheesecake filling over the crust and freeze for at least two hours until firm.
  5. Mix crushed cookies with freeze-dried strawberries or Jell-O powder, adding melted butter until well coated.
  6. Cut the cheesecake into bite-sized pieces and roll each piece in the strawberry coating.
